A principle or regulation that must be followed; or to have control over a country or people.

Example Sentence

The school rule states that students must not use their phones during class.

Usage Note

Used to describe established guidelines, laws, or principles that dictate how something should be done or how people should behave. It's essential for maintaining order, fairness, and predictability in various settings, from games and sports to governments and societies.
